2,4-Dichloro-5-methoxypyrimidine Use and Manufacturing

Methods of Manufacturing

Intermediate 2: 2, 4-Dichloro- -methoxypyrimidine2, 4-Dihydroxy-5-methoxypyrimidine (45g, 0.316mol), phosphorous oxychloride (225mL, 0.88mol), and Ν, Ν-dimethylaniline (45mL, 0.391mol) were heated under reflux for 2h. The mixture was poured onto crushed ice (80 g.), and the product collected in ether. Recrystallisation from light petroleum (b.p: 40-60 °C) gave 2, 4- dichloro-5-methoxypyrimidine (43g, 75percent).Mass: (ES+) 179 (M+H)2, 4-Dichloro-5-methoxy-pyrimidine[0082] In ice bath, dimethyl-phenyl-amine (6.58 ml, 51.65 mmol, 0.5 eq) was added dropwise to a slurry of 5-methoxy-pyrimidine-2, 4-diol (14.68 g, 1.0 eq) in POCI3 (47.42 ml, 5.0 eq) and refluxed overnight. Uses

Used for preparation of heteroarylpiperazine derivatives for use in treatment of Alzheimer's disease.
